Art. 14 Categories

1 Un­manned air­craft, in par­tic­u­lar manned kites, paragliders, tethered bal­loons, free-fly­ing bal­loons and mod­el air­craft that weigh more than 30 kg may only be flown with au­thor­isa­tion from FO­CA. The FO­CA shall spe­cify the re­quire­ments for au­thor­isa­tion and the op­er­at­ing con­di­tions on a case-by-case basis.

2 Third party li­ab­il­ity claims made by third parties on the ground must be covered by the air­craft pro­pri­et­or in a third party li­ab­il­ity in­sur­ance policy with guar­an­teed cov­er of at least one mil­lion francs.
